Cirrus-logic CRD5376 User Manual Page 47

  • Download
  • Add to my manuals
  • Print
  • Page
    / 68
  • Table of contents
  • BOOKMARKS
  • Rated. / 5. Based on customer reviews
Page view 46
CRD5376
DS612RD2 47
3.5.4 Macros
The Macros sub-panel is designed to write a large number of registers with a single command. This al-
lows the target evaluation system to be quickly set into a specific state for testing.
The Register control gives access to both digital filter registers and SPI1 registers. These registers can
be written with data from the Data control, or data can be read and output to a text window. The Register
control can also select special commands to be executed, with the Data control used to define a param-
eter value for the special command, if necessary.
3.5.5 GPIO
The GPIO sub-panel controls the digital filter GPIO pin configurations. GPIO pins have dedicated func-
tions on the target board, but can be used in any manner for custom designs.
Control Description
Write / Read Selects the type of operation to be performed by the inserted macro command.
Register Selects the target register for the inserted macro command. Also selects special
commands that can be performed.
Data Sets the register data value for the inserted macro command. Also sets the parame-
ter value for special commands.
Clear Clears the currently displayed macro.
Load Loads a previously saved macro.
Save Saves the currently displayed macro. Macros can be saved with unique names or
can be saved as External Macros.
Insert Inserts a macro command at the selected macro line. The macro command is built
from the Write/Read, Register, and Data controls.
Delete Deletes the macro command at the selected macro line.
Macro1 - Macro4 Selects which of the four working macros is displayed.
Run Runs the currently displayed working macro.
Control Description
Direction Sets the selected GPIO pin as an output (*) or input ( ).
Pull Up Turns the pull up resistor for the selected GPIO pin on (*) or off ( ).
Data Sets the selected output GPIO pin to a high (*) or low ( ) level.
Write Initiates a write to GPIO registers.The Direction, Pull Up and Data controls are read
to determine the register values to be written.
Read Initiates a read from GPIO registers.The Direction, Pull Up and Data controls are
updated based on the register values that are read.
Page view 46
1 2 ... 42 43 44 45 46 47 48 49 50 51 52 ... 67 68

Comments to this Manuals

No comments